    3DMark 2003 Having None Of It.

    Arse. I am not amused.

    Right lads, I can't run 3DMark 2003 on my rig, X800XT-PE included.

    Everything is 100% stable, in Windows, during gaming, all the time. I have the latest drivers for everything, latest DirectX, etc, etc.

    I've tried the latest Cats and Omegas, and I get the same problem: There's no problem running the actuall game tests, my card eats them up, the first test, Wings of Fury, peaks at a rather silly reported FPS of 1442.

    The problem is switching from the first test to the second; as its about to switch, and the screen goes blank, it exits to the desktop.

    As I said, temps are fine, system is 100% stable, all latest drivers.

    I've disabled the first test, and started with the second, and again, it exits to the desktop when the test is finished and it goes blank to load the third.

    Even started at the first CPU test; same again, runs the test fine, exits to desktop when changing between the first and second test.

    2 hours of Doom III - not a flicker.

    Whats going on? Getting on my tits a bit now.

    Monitor has correct and latest driver as well, by the way.

    Bloody thing, I want to post some benchmarks, everyone's moaning at me, and I can't get the twating prog to run.

    Any ideas, because I've lost patience with it?
